What is a key-programmer?

Key programmer is a tool used to change the transponder code in a car or truck fob or key. This process is necessary when a new key or fob has to be programmed. This process is typically required when a key or fob is lost or stolen. The device basically reprograms the digital signature of the chip inside the key to match the signature of the vehicle, and allows it to start.

Some vehicles have electronic immobilizer systems that stop theft by stopping the engine from starting without the correct fob key programming or key. This is accomplished by having the car's system check to make sure that the fob or key has the correct digital signature. If it does not, the system will shut down. This kind of system has been proven to be effective in reducing the incidence of theft and has been made mandatory for various models of vehicles by the manufacturer.

Most of these anti-theft systems are controlled by a module installed in the vehicle's engine instrument cluster, instrument cluster, or ignition lock. In some instances the modules require special keys that have been designed by experts to work with the antitheft system. This is typically done by a dealer, or locksmith using computers.

Although it is possible to reprogram some fobs and keys at home but it is not advised unless you're a highly skilled technician in the field of automotive. A key that is not properly programmed could cause the vehicle not to begin, stop running or even break. The majority of auto manufacturers have a very precise procedure for programming these keys.

How do I program an electronic key?

Key programmer devices can be used to modify the keys of your car. It reads the information from the microchip that is in your key, and then write new data to the chip. This will allow you use the key and ensure that it is functioning correctly. The process of using a programer isn't easy and requires technical knowledge. Before you attempt to make this yourself, consult a professional locksmith or professional for instructions.

You can also buy an online key programmer and have it professionally programmed at less than the cost to have a dealership do the work. It is important to know that not all key programmers products are compatible with your vehicle. Before making a purchase it is important to make sure that the product is compatible with your vehicle.

Most of the time you'll require having your key fob reset by a dealer. This is because the key fob needs to be reprogrammed with specific data for your vehicle's anti-theft system. Dealers will usually need to have the VIN number of your car to do this and they usually charge a fee for this. You can save money by providing your dealer a copy which you are capable of obtaining from the DMV of all states.

For certain cars you can also try to reprogram your key if you have another working key that is compatible with your vehicle. This is called master key method, and it can be used to program a second key on some vehicles. If you have a GM car, for example, insert your key into the ignition until the security light turns off. Once the security light has gone out, you can take off the working key and insert the new one.

You can also purchase a specialized EEPROM Key Programmer. This is a more costly but more effective method of programming the car key. However, this is a much more advanced technology that requires removing the car and reading the information from the microchip in the key. This type of programming is best suited to skilled automotive technicians with extensive experience in electronic repair.
